Oktagon 70's Andrej Kalasnik on Sparring Prochazka: "You Try to Stay Alive"
Briefly

Andrej Kalasnik, a welterweight fighter, shares how his mentality shift towards enjoying MMA has positively influenced his performance. Preparing for a fight against Mate Kertesz, Kalasnik reveals that the birth of his son has made him approach fights with less pressure. Previously, he focused on securing wins rather than enjoying the process, which sometimes led to unexciting performances. Now, he aims to be entertaining in the ring, recognizing that MMA also involves show business. Positive fan feedback indicates his entertaining approach is resonating well as he seeks a title shot.
I started to enjoy more, MMA. Even when I had a seven fight win streak, I was like, 'I cannot lose,' and my fights sometimes were boring.
This is the most important thing for me. MMA is a sport, but it's show business. At the end of the day, you need to put on some show.
I see it from the fans or I see it from the internet that they like me more, so I'm grateful for this.
